模糊推理方法( 总 1 1 页) --本 页 仅 作 为文 档 封 面 , 使 用 时 请 直 接 删 除 即 可 -- --内 页 可 以 根 据 需 求 调 整 合 适 字 体 及 大 小 -- 22 几种典型的模糊推理方法 根据模糊推理的定义可知,模糊推理的结论主要取决于模糊蕴含关系),(~YXR及模糊关系与模糊集合之间的合成运算法则。对于确定的模糊推理系统,模糊蕴含关系),(~YXR一般是确定的,而合成运算法则并不唯一。根据合成运算法则的不同,模糊推理方法又可分为 Mamdani 推理法、Larsen 推理法、Zadeh 推理法等等。 一、Mamdani 模糊推理法 Mamdani 模糊推理法是最常用的一种推理方法,其模糊蕴涵关系),(~YXRM定义简单,可以通过模糊集合 A~ 和 B~ 的笛卡尔积(取小)求得,即 )()(),(~~~yxyxBARM 例 已知 模糊集 合3211.04.01~xxxA,33211.03.05.08.0~yyyyB。求模糊集合 A~ 和 B~ 之间的模糊蕴含关系),(~YXRM。 解:根据 Mamdani 模糊蕴含关系的定义可知: 1.01.01.01.01.03.04.04.01.03.05.08.0]1.03.05.08.0[1.04.01~~),(~BAYXRM Mamdani 将经典的极大—极小合成运算方法作为模糊关系与模糊集合的合成运算法则。在此定义下,Mamdani 模糊推理过程易于进行图形解释。下面通过几种具体情况来分析 Mamdani 模糊推理过程。 (i) 具有单个前件的单一规则 设*~A 和 A~ 论域 X 上的模糊集合, B~ 是论域 Y 上的模糊集合, A~ 和 B~ 间的模糊关系是),(~YXRM,有 大前提(规则): if x is A~ then y is B~ 小前提(事实): x is *~A 结论: y is ),(~~~**YXRABM 当)()(),(~~~yxyxBARM时,有 33 )()}()]()({[V)]}()([)({V)(~~~~Xx~~~Xx~***yyxxyxxyBBAABAAB 其中)]()([V~~Xx*xxAA,称为 A~ 和*~A 的适配度。 在给定模糊集合*~A 、 A~ 及 B~ 的情况下,Mamdani 模糊推理的结果*~B 如图所示。 01A~x*~A01B~y*~B 图 单前提单规则的推理过程 根据 Mamdani 推理方法可知,欲求*~B ,应先求出适配度 (即)()(~~*xxAA的最大值);然后用适配度 去切割 B~ 的 MF,即可获得推论结果*~B ,如图中后件部分的阴影区域。所以这种方法经常又形象地称为削顶法。 对于单前件单规则(即若 x 是 ...